Soho House Opens Buckinghamshire Estate 45 Minutes From London Core

The members-club operator extends its UK footprint beyond urban cores, testing exurban appeal amid £300M refinancing pressure.

Soho House launched a new members' venue in Buckinghamshire, 45 minutes outside central London, marking the brand's first satellite-location experiment in its home market. The property expands the group's London-area footprint to eight locations, adding country-house access to a membership base that historically clustered around Soho, Shoreditch, and White City addresses. The opening arrives as the company navigates a £300 million debt refinancing scheduled for mid-2025 and seeks revenue diversification beyond its 42 urban Houses worldwide.

The Buckinghamshire site represents a structural shift in Soho House's real-estate strategy. Where previous UK locations occupied repurposed industrial buildings or townhouse conversions in Zone 1 and Zone 2 postcodes, this property targets the weekend-escape segment—members willing to drive rather than walk. The move mirrors hospitality operators like Lime Wood and Heckfield Place, which built £500-plus per-night businesses serving London wealth without London rents. Soho House already operates country properties in Oxfordshire (Soho Farmhouse, opened 2015) and Babington House in Somerset (acquired 1998), but both predate the brand's 2021 SPAC merger and subsequent membership scaling to over 200,000 globally.

The timing matters for three constituencies. First, the brand's 2024 EBITDA guidance of £90-95 million depends on per-member revenue growth, not just headcount expansion. Satellite locations with lower property costs but retained membership-fee capture improve unit economics if utilization holds. Second, competitors like The Ned and Mortimer House are testing similar exurban plays—The Ned announced a Cotswolds site in late 2023, though construction timelines remain unpublished. Third, the luxury-hospitality development community is watching whether members-club operators can command the £2,000-plus annual fees that sustain their models when the core amenity sits an hour outside the city, not ten minutes from Mayfair.

Operators and allocators should track Q1 2025 membership data for Soho House's UK segment, specifically whether Buckinghamshire drives net-new sign-ups or simply redistributes existing member visits. The company reports segmented revenue by geography but not by individual House, making utilization inference indirect. Worth noting: Soho Farmhouse runs at 90-plus percent weekend occupancy year-round, but that property offers 40 overnight rooms alongside day-use facilities, while early reports suggest the Buckinghamshire site skews toward day membership rather than accommodation. If the model works, expect Soho House to replicate within 12-18 months in commuter-belt markets around New York (Westchester, Hudson Valley) and Los Angeles (Ojai, Santa Barbara county).

The UK now accounts for 38 percent of Soho House's global membership base, making it the test bed for any format innovation before international rollout. The Buckinghamshire opening arrives six months before the company's debt maturity, positioning the brand to show lenders it can grow without the capital intensity of urban ground-up builds. The next comparable signal: whether The Ned's Cotswolds property breaks ground before summer 2025, or whether Soho House's experiment freezes the sector until unit economics prove out.
